I'm using safari on iOS 16 looking at a youtube.com page for a live stream that allegedly has not started and is scheduled to start sometime in the future (since it's marked as upcoming in the UI). I'm logged in to my account.

The video player simply says:

Waiting for channel name

13 December 2024 19:02

Now I assumed that this would be the scheduled time for it to start, and that would've been great except that that was five hours ago.

At this point I usually assume wrong time zone settings, so I inspected general settings and noted that both location and language were set to Sweden and Swedish respectively, which is correct. I found no other regional settings whatsoever.

My OS already has the correct local time and time zone, and I did not find any disabled "experimental" Safari API pertaining to this in iOS settings.

  • Is the time stamp the scheduled starting time?
  • Which time zone is it in?
  • Are there time zone settings somewhere, that I did not find?

If time stamps aren't in my local time zone then I don't understand either a) who they're for, or b) why the time zone isn't explicit. As it currently stands I can't seem to make any use of the time stamp — not even to determine that "the live stream didn't start at the scheduled time", since other parts of the UI imply the opposite.
